Op deze website gebruiken we cookies om content en advertenties te personaliseren, om functies voor social media te bieden en om ons websiteverkeer te analyseren. Ook delen we informatie over uw gebruik van onze site met onze partners voor social media, adverteren en analyse. Deze partners kunnen deze gegevens combineren met andere informatie die u aan ze heeft verstrekt of die ze hebben verzameld op basis van uw gebruik van hun services. Meer informatie.

Akkoord

Vraag & Antwoord

Programmeren

code uit executable halen (VB6)

h4xX0r
8 antwoorden
  • Is er iemand die weet hoe ik de code terug kan krijgen uit een executable? Door een crash ben ik mijn source-code verloren. Ik heb nog een executable van de applicatie. Is de code hier op een of andere manier weer uit te halen?

    (Ik werkt met Basic 6.0)
  • 'k geloof niet dat dat helemaal legaal is. Zou mooi zijn, als je de code van bv Word zou kunnen krijgen :)
  • Wat een onzin! sinds wanneer is het illegaal om je eigen broncode te gebruiken.
    We mogen er toch vanuit gaan dat deze poster ter goeder trouw is!

    Wat je nodig hebt is een zogenaamde "unpacker" een zoektocht op het net zal wel de nodige links opleveren (van uiteraard legale trail versies…)
  • Discompiler
    Word is niet geschreven in VB6.0, dus die kun je ook niet duiscompilen.

    Voor VB6 zijn echter geen echt goede discompilers op de markt, aangezien Microsoft een anti-discompile-beveiliging erin heeft gebouwd.
  • heeft niets met VB of VC te maken.En ja, je mag je eigen code decompilen, alleen is de stap naar een ander programma klein. Word was maar een voorbeeld, maar er zijn legio programma's in VB geschreven.
  • Zo'n ding heet toch een "decompiler"? ;)
  • Of discompilr jah.
    DiDo heeft er voor VB3 een gemaakt, heb ík dankbaar gebruik van gemaakt… had een virus ;-)
    VB6 zijn nog geen betrouwbare voor, jammer maar helaas.
  • [quote:b4b8e4a040="rkuiper"]Is er iemand die weet hoe ik de code terug kan krijgen uit een executable? Door een crash ben ik mijn source-code verloren. Ik heb nog een executable van de applicatie. Is de code hier op een of andere manier weer uit te halen?

    (Ik werkt met Basic 6.0)[/quote:b4b8e4a040]

    sorrie, voor VB6 is geen ik herhaal geen decomiler te vinden.
    VB6 wordt namelijk anders gecompileerd als zijn voorgangers VB4 en terug. Van procedureel naar Native, En dit is technisch niet mogelijk.
    Als je op google zoekt naar een decomiler VB6 lijkt het erop dat je het zult vinden. Maar let op ! Het bestaat niet. reverse engineering is helaas zeker bij de nieuwere talen absoluut onmogelijk.

Beantwoord deze vraag

Dit is een gearchiveerde pagina. Antwoorden is niet meer mogelijk.